为庞大的门户网站构建数据库

时间:2010-12-14 05:40:03

标签: java php mysql database

如果我想建立一个类似于IMDB的电影网站。 我可以启动并运行该网站。 从我发布的那天起,我可以保持最新的数据, 但我的问题是,在我看来,我怎么能想到从1900年到2010年提供旧数据

这是我所面临的挑战,任何人都可以分享知识如何去做吗? 我可以遵循哪种策略来制作任何网站以使其具有旧的和正在进行的新闻

说我开发这个网站的技术可能是java,mysql,php

如何让旧数据显示从1900年到2010年* 意思是:我想上传所有非常老的电影数据

1 个答案:

答案 0 :(得分:0)

我没有在这里看到问题。只需将所有电影的数据存储在数据库中,并为用户提供以下方式:

  • 使用日期范围限定他/她的搜索,
  • 按日期顺序订购结果。
  

我想上传所有非常老的电影数据

你有什么理由不这样做吗? (除了显而易见的首先没有数据......)

<强>后续

听起来你担心的问题是数据不完整或不好。没有简单的解决方案。你可能需要设计一个处理它的策略; e.g。

  • 上传所有内容,然后在实时数据库上进行批量验证/清理运行
  • 如上所述,但隐藏记录直到通过验证
  • 在您尝试上传时验证每条记录,并将那些未通过验证的记录放在一边。

您还需要能够:

  • 识别常见验证问题,并执行批量修正,
  • 动态更改(例如收紧)验证规则并重新验证。

但这是大型面向数据的应用程序的标准内容。 (并且有简单的解决方案,每个人和他们的奶奶都会抓住互联网并建立数据库.TANSTAAFL。)